Is Priano Red Wine Vinegar Gluten Free?

Description
Tangy and moderately acidic, it offers a bright, slightly fruity sharpness and a clean, thin texture that blends readily. Commonly used in vinaigrettes, marinades, dressings, deglazing pans, and pickling, reviewers note consistent flavor, reliable acidity, good value, and occasional comments about intensity being stronger than expected by some users overall.

Ingredients
Red Wine Vinegar Diluted With Water To 5% Acidity. Contains: Sulfites.
What is a Gluten Free diet?
A gluten-free diet excludes all foods containing gluten, a protein found in wheat, barley, rye, and their derivatives. It's essential for people with celiac disease, gluten intolerance, or wheat allergy, as consuming gluten can trigger inflammation and digestive issues. Common gluten-containing foods include bread, pasta, cereals, and baked goods, though many gluten-free alternatives now exist using rice, corn, or almond flour. Beyond medical necessity, some people choose a gluten-free lifestyle for perceived health benefits, though experts emphasize the importance of maintaining a balanced diet rich in fiber, vitamins, and minerals when eliminating gluten-containing grains.
